

AWS Der Application Discovery Service steht Neukunden nicht mehr zur Verfügung. Verwenden Sie alternativ eines AWS Transform , das ähnliche Funktionen bietet. Weitere Informationen finden Sie unter [Änderung der Verfügbarkeit von AWS Application Discovery Service](https://docs.aws.amazon.com/application-discovery/latest/userguide/application-discovery-service-availability-change.html).

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

# Ermitteln Sie Ihre Datenbankserver
<a name="agentless-collector-gs-database-analytics-collection-discovery"></a>

Dieser Abschnitt führt Sie durch die Schritte, die Sie zur Konfiguration Ihres Betriebssystems und Ihrer Datenbankserver ausführen müssen. Anschließend ermitteln Sie Ihre Server und haben die Möglichkeit, manuell einen Datenbank- oder Analyseserver hinzuzufügen. 

Für die Datenbankerkennung müssen Sie Benutzer für Ihre Quelldatenbanken mit den für das Datenerfassungsmodul erforderlichen Mindestberechtigungen erstellen. Weitere Informationen finden Sie im *Benutzerhandbuch* unter [Datenbankbenutzer für AWS DMS Fleet Advisor erstellen](https://docs.aws.amazon.com/dms/latest/userguide/fa-database-users.html).AWS DMS 

# Konfiguration, Einrichtung
<a name="agentless-collector-gs-database-analytics-collection-discovery-setup"></a>

Um die Datenbanken zu ermitteln, die auf den zuvor hinzugefügten OS-Servern laufen, benötigt das Datenerfassungsmodul Zugriff auf das Betriebssystem und die Datenbankserver. Auf dieser Seite werden die Schritte beschrieben, die Sie ergreifen müssen, um sicherzustellen, dass auf Ihre Datenbank über den Port zugegriffen werden kann, den Sie in den Verbindungseinstellungen angegeben haben. Außerdem aktivieren Sie die Remoteauthentifizierung auf Ihrem Datenbankserver und erteilen Ihrem Datenerfassungsmodul Berechtigungen.

## Konfiguration unter Linux
<a name="agentless-collector-gs-database-analytics-collection-discovery-linux"></a>

Gehen Sie wie folgt vor, um das Setup für die Erkennung von Datenbankservern unter Linux zu konfigurieren.

**So konfigurieren Sie Linux für die Erkennung von Datenbankservern**

1. Gewähren Sie sudo-Zugriff auf die `netstat` Befehle `ss` und.

   Das folgende Codebeispiel gewährt sudo-Zugriff auf die Befehle `ss` und`netstat`.

   ```
   sudo bash -c "cat << EOF >> /etc/sudoers.d/username
   username ALL=(ALL) NOPASSWD: /usr/bin/ss
   username ALL=(ALL) NOPASSWD: /usr/bin/netstat 
   EOF"
   ```

   Ersetzen Sie es im vorherigen Beispiel `username` durch den Namen des Linux-Benutzers, den Sie in den Anmeldeinformationen für die Verbindung zum Betriebssystemserver angegeben haben.

   Im vorherigen Beispiel wird der `/usr/bin/` Pfad zu den `netstat` Befehlen `ss` und verwendet. Dieser Pfad kann in Ihrer Umgebung anders sein. Um den Pfad zu den `netstat` Befehlen `ss` und zu ermitteln, führen Sie die `which netstat` Befehle `which ss` and aus.

1. Konfigurieren Sie Ihre Linux-Server so, dass sie die Ausführung von SSH-Skripts und den ICMP-Verkehr (Internet Control Message Protocol) zulassen.

## Konfiguration unter Microsoft Windows
<a name="agentless-collector-gs-database-analytics-collection-discovery-windows"></a>

Gehen Sie wie folgt vor, um das Setup für die Erkennung von Datenbankservern unter Microsoft Windows zu konfigurieren.

**So konfigurieren Sie Microsoft Windows für die Erkennung von Datenbankservern**

1. Geben Sie Anmeldeinformationen ein, um Abfragen mit Windows Management Instrumentation (WMI) und WMI Query Language (WQL) auszuführen und die Registrierung zu lesen.

1. Fügen Sie den Windows-Benutzer, den Sie in den Anmeldeinformationen für die Verbindung mit dem Betriebssystemserver angegeben haben, den folgenden Gruppen hinzu: Distributed COM Users, Performance Log-Benutzer, Performance Monitor-Benutzer und Event Log Readers. Verwenden Sie dazu das folgende Codebeispiel.

   ```
   net localgroup "Distributed COM Users" username /ADD
   net localgroup "Performance Log Users" username /ADD
   net localgroup "Performance Monitor Users" username /ADD
   net localgroup "Event Log Readers" username /ADD
   ```

   Ersetzen Sie es im vorherigen Beispiel durch den Namen des Windows-Benutzers, den Sie in den Anmeldeinformationen für die Verbindung `username` mit dem Betriebssystemserver angegeben haben.

1. Erteilen Sie dem Windows-Benutzer, den Sie in den Anmeldeinformationen für die Verbindung mit dem Betriebssystemserver angegeben haben, die erforderlichen Berechtigungen.
   + Wählen Sie unter **Eigenschaften für Windows-Verwaltung und Instrumentierung** die Option **Lokaler Start** und **Remoteaktivierung** aus.
   + Wählen Sie für die **WMI-Steuerung** die Berechtigungen **Methoden ausführen**, **Konto aktivieren**, **Fernaktivierung** und **Lesesicherheit** für die `WMI` Namespaces `CIMV2``DEFAULT`,`StandartCimv2`, und aus.
   + ****Führen Sie das **WMI-Plug-In** aus und wählen Sie dann `winrm configsddl default` Lesen und Ausführen.****

1. Konfigurieren Sie Ihren Windows-Host mithilfe des folgenden Codebeispiels.

   ```
   netsh advfirewall firewall add rule name="Open Ports for WinRM incoming traffic" dir=in action=allow protocol=TCP localport=5985, 5986 # Opens ports for WinRM 
   netsh advfirewall firewall add rule name="All ICMP V4" protocol=icmpv4:any,any dir=in action=allow # Allows ICPM traffic
   
   Enable-PSRemoting -Force # Enables WinRM
   Set-Service WinRM -StartMode Automatic # Allows WinRM service to run on host startup 
   Set-Item WSMan:\localhost\Client\TrustedHosts -Value {IP} -Force # Sets the specific IP from which the access to WinRM is allowed
   
   winrm set winrm/config/service '@{Negotiation="true"}' # Allow Negosiate auth usage
   winrm set winrm/config/service '@{AllowUnencrypted="true"}' # Allow unencrypted connection
   ```

# Ermitteln Sie einen Datenbankserver
<a name="agentless-collector-gs-database-analytics-collection-discovery-tutorial"></a>

Führen Sie die folgenden Aufgaben aus, um Datenbankserver auf der Konsole zu finden und hinzuzufügen.

**Um mit der Erkennung Ihrer Datenbankserver zu beginnen**

1. Wählen Sie auf der **Collector-Seite für Datenbanken und Analysen** im Navigationsbereich unter **Discovery** die Option **OS-Server** aus.

1. Wählen Sie die Betriebssystemserver aus, zu denen Ihre Datenbank- und Analyseserver gehören, und wählen Sie dann im Menü **Aktionen** die Option **Verbindung überprüfen** aus.

1. Bearbeiten Sie bei Servern mit dem **Konnektivitätsstatus** **Fehlgeschlagen** die Verbindungsanmeldedaten.

   1. Wählen Sie einen einzelnen Server oder mehrere Server aus, wenn sie identische Anmeldeinformationen haben, und wählen Sie dann im Menü **Aktionen** die Option **Bearbeiten** aus. Die Seite **„Betriebssystemserver bearbeiten**“ wird geöffnet.

   1. Geben Sie für **Port** die Portnummer ein, die für Remote-Abfragen verwendet wird.

   1. Wählen Sie **unter Authentifizierungstyp** den Authentifizierungstyp aus, den Ihr Betriebssystemserver verwendet.

   1. Geben Sie **unter Benutzername** den Benutzernamen ein, den Sie für die Verbindung mit Ihrem OS-Server verwenden.

   1. Geben Sie unter **Passwort** das Passwort ein, mit dem Sie eine Verbindung zu Ihrem OS-Server herstellen.

   1. Wählen Sie **Verbindung überprüfen**, um sicherzustellen, dass Sie Ihre Betriebssystemserver-Anmeldeinformationen korrekt aktualisiert haben. Wählen Sie als Nächstes **Speichern**.

1. Nachdem Sie die Anmeldeinformationen für alle Betriebssystemserver aktualisiert haben, wählen Sie Ihre Betriebssystemserver aus und wählen **Sie Discover database servers**.

Das Modul zur Erfassung von Datenbank- und Analysedaten stellt eine Verbindung zu Ihren Betriebssystemservern her und erkennt die unterstützten Datenbank- und Analyseserver. Nachdem das Datenerfassungsmodul die Erkennung abgeschlossen hat, können Sie die Liste der erkannten Datenbank- und Analyseserver anzeigen, indem Sie **Datenbankserver anzeigen** wählen.

Alternativ können Sie Ihre Datenbank- und Analyseserver manuell zum Inventar hinzufügen. Sie können die Serverliste auch aus einer CSV-Datei importieren. Sie können diesen Schritt überspringen, wenn Sie bereits alle Datenbank- und Analyseserver zum Inventar hinzugefügt haben.

**Um einen Datenbank- oder Analyseserver manuell hinzuzufügen**

1. Wählen Sie auf der Seite **Datenbank- und Analyse-Collector** im Navigationsbereich die Option **Datenerfassung** aus.

1. Wählen Sie **Datenbankserver hinzufügen** aus. Die Seite **Datenbankserver hinzufügen** wird geöffnet.

1. Geben Sie Ihre Anmeldeinformationen für den Datenbankserver ein.

   1. Wählen Sie für **Datenbank-Engine** die Datenbank-Engine Ihres Servers aus. Weitere Informationen finden Sie unter [Unterstützte Betriebssystem-, Datenbank- und Analyseserver](agentless-collector-gs-database-analytics-collection.md#agentless-collector-gs-database-analytics-collection-supported-servers). 

   1. Geben Sie für **Hostname/IP** den Hostnamen oder die IP-Adresse Ihres Datenbank- oder Analyseservers ein.

   1. Geben Sie für **Port** den Port ein, auf dem Ihr Server läuft.

   1. Wählen Sie **unter Authentifizierungstyp** den Authentifizierungstyp aus, den Ihr Datenbank- oder Analyseserver verwendet.

   1. Geben Sie **unter Benutzername** den Benutzernamen ein, den Sie für die Verbindung mit Ihrem Server verwenden.

   1. Geben Sie **unter Passwort** das Passwort ein, mit dem Sie eine Verbindung zu Ihrem Server herstellen.

   1. Wählen Sie **Überprüfen**, um sicherzustellen, dass Sie Ihre Datenbank- oder Analytics-Server-Anmeldeinformationen korrekt hinzugefügt haben.

1. (Optional) Fügen Sie mehrere Server aus einer CSV-Datei hinzu.

   1. Wählen Sie **Datenbankserver in großen Mengen aus CSV importieren**.

   1. Wählen Sie **Vorlage herunterladen**, um eine CSV-Datei zu speichern, die eine Vorlage enthält, die Sie anpassen können.

   1. Geben Sie die Verbindungsanmeldedaten für Ihre Datenbank- und Analyseserver entsprechend der Vorlage in die Datei ein. Das folgende Beispiel zeigt, wie Sie die Anmeldeinformationen für die Datenbank- oder Analyseserver-Verbindung in einer CSV-Datei angeben können.

      ```
      Database engine,Hostname/IP,Port,Authentication type,Username,Password,Oracle service name,Database,Allow public key retrieval,Use SSL,Trust server certificate
      Oracle,192.0.2.1,1521,Login/Password authentication,USER-EXAMPLE,AKIAI44QH8DHBEXAMPLE,orcl,,,,
      PostgreSQL,198.51.100.1,1533,Login/Password authentication,USER2-EXAMPLE,bPxRfiCYEXAMPLE,,postgre,,TRUE,
      MSSQL,203.0.113.1,1433,Login/Password authentication,USER3-EXAMPLE,h3yCo8nvbEXAMPLE,,,,,TRUE
      MySQL,2001:db8:4006:812:ffff:200e,8080,Login/Password authentication,USER4-EXAMPLE,APKAEIVFHP46CEXAMPLE,,mysql,TRUE,TRUE,
      ```

      Speichern Sie Ihre CSV-Datei, nachdem Sie Anmeldeinformationen für alle Ihre Datenbank- und Analyseserver hinzugefügt haben.

   1. Wählen Sie **Durchsuchen** und dann Ihre CSV-Datei aus.

1. Wählen **Sie Datenbankserver hinzufügen**.

1. Nachdem Sie Anmeldeinformationen für alle Betriebssystemserver hinzugefügt haben, wählen Sie Ihre Betriebssystemserver aus und klicken Sie auf **Datenbankserver ermitteln**.

Nachdem Sie alle Ihre Datenbank- und Analyseserver zum Datenerfassungsmodul hinzugefügt haben, fügen Sie sie dem Inventar hinzu. Das Modul zur Erfassung von Datenbank- und Analysedaten kann vom Inventar aus eine Verbindung zu den Servern herstellen und sammelt Metadaten und Leistungsmetriken.

**Um Ihre Datenbank- und Analyseserver zum Inventar hinzuzufügen**

1. Wählen Sie auf der **Collector-Seite für Datenbanken und Analysen** im Navigationsbereich unter **Discovery** die Option **Datenbankserver** aus.

1. Wählen Sie die Datenbank- und Analyseserver aus, für die Sie Metadaten und Leistungsmetriken sammeln möchten.

1. Wählen Sie **Zum Inventar hinzufügen** aus.

Nachdem Sie alle Datenbank- und Analyseserver zu Ihrem Inventar hinzugefügt haben, können Sie mit der Erfassung von Metadaten und Leistungsmetriken beginnen. Weitere Informationen finden Sie unter [Erfassung von Datenbank- und Analysedaten](agentless-collector-dashboard.md#using-collector-data-collect-database-analytics).